Output b70f32b9b4bfbbaadc2063649cf1c23be33ea531c6e0ef49dc4c8ece7ff71fc9:8

value
209377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0269d474942b6f2a7745eb6f8682001f106d4b3 OP_EQUAL
address
3N8DYVD4cCYJGCuu7wshkqpTRBmXACrR3z
transaction
b70f32b9b4bfbbaadc2063649cf1c23be33ea531c6e0ef49dc4c8ece7ff71fc9
confirmations
284007
spent
true